Output 089579e280ebd5aeff66533c66558fd32cd24de9da7cebabec67665d6dadbd06:1

value
908336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c68900944ef021de54a92f0d2a798da87f51ef0 OP_EQUALVERIFY OP_CHECKSIG
address
16WQoefyuB3aE8qJLM3ERgUgV16DZVrMpQ
transaction
089579e280ebd5aeff66533c66558fd32cd24de9da7cebabec67665d6dadbd06
spent
false

2 Sat Ranges